You don't have to use high unit detail on huge. Thing is, to keep at least kind of an overview you are forced to watch the battle from far above, eliminating most advanced textures.
I also use large size, it seems to be a good balance between troop management and battle grandeur.
Further 'huge' disadvantages are
1) the restricted battlefield size which severly hurts maneuverability when two huge full-stack armies clash, forcing you -more or less- to slam your units into the enemy rather than pulling off fancy maneuvers.
2) the limitation of the camera on the general which is quite annoying since you have to double-click on units deployed towards the far ends of your line to properly maneuver them, often losing precious seconds in the zoom.
Of course, this doesn't apply if you switch off the general's cam and play god, the alwatchy. Not very realistic IMHO.
